UBS: Fed's economic plan is not achievable

EPA-EFE/MAURITZ ANTIN

UBS Chief Economist for the United States, Jonathan Pingle, said Monday that the Fed's economic plan to normalize economic conditions is impossible to achieve.

"We were in the soft landing camp for most of last year, but the path to that unfolding has narrowed considerably with the data coming since September," Pingle told The Australian Financial Review, arguing that the soft landing would need strong employment, lower inflation, and the Fed easing the brakes.

"Trying to have an increase in the unemployment rate and inflation fall and do so painlessly, I think it's impossible," he asserted.
